Bug#756494: print-manager: Authentication Dialog cannot receive focus

2014-07-30 Thread Sander van Grieken
Package: print-manager
Version: 4:4.13.3-1
Severity: grave
Justification: renders package unusable

When configuring an existing printer through the printer KCM module (as normal
user), authentication is not possible when clicking Configure, makig changes
there, and pressing Apply. The authentication dialog pops up, but cannot
receive focus.

When the authentication dialog pops up as a result of checking the 'Default
Printer' or 'Reject Print Jobs' checkbox, the authentication dialog is able to
receive focus, and these settings seems to apply after auth.

So it is likely due to two modal dialogs competing for focus
